Factors Influencing Ripple’s Price Stability
Ripple’s price stability can be attributed to a few key factors. Firstly, the company behind Ripple, Ripple Labs, has focused on building strategic partnerships with major financial institutions like Santander and American Express. These partnerships not only help promote XRP as a bridge currency for cross-border transactions but also reduce the speculative nature often associated with cryptocurrencies.
Utility and Real-World Use Cases
Ripple’s primary use case—cross-border payments—has proven to be in high demand, especially in regions where traditional banking infrastructure is less efficient. This real-world utility gives XRP a tangible purpose, further supporting its stability compared to other cryptos that may lack a clear use case or adoption.
Market Perception and Regulatory Landscape
Ripple’s consistent regulatory compliance also plays a significant role in its price stability. Ripple has worked hard to engage with regulators, ensuring that XRP remains compliant in various jurisdictions. This proactive approach helps reduce regulatory uncertainty, fostering a more stable market environment for the digital asset.
In conclusion, Ripple’s price stability is influenced by strategic partnerships, real-world utility, and regulatory compliance. These factors combined make XRP a strong contender in the crypto market with potential for sustainable growth.
